Understanding House Edge in Online Casinos
When you start playing at an online casino, one term you’ll frequently encounter is «house edge.» This mathematical advantage is crucial to understand if you want to gamble responsibly and know what to expect from your gaming sessions.
What Is House Edge?
The house edge represents the percentage advantage that the casino maintains over players in any given game. It’s built into every game’s rules and odds, ensuring that over time, the casino profits from player losses. For example, if a game has a 2% house edge, the casino expects to keep approximately $2 for every $100 wagered.
House Edge Across Different Games
Different games offer varying house edges. Blackjack typically features some of the lowest edges, often between 0.5% and 1% with proper strategy. Slot machines, conversely, usually have higher edges ranging from 2% to 15%, depending on the game and casino.
Roulette falls somewhere in the middle, with American roulette offering a 5.26% house edge due to the double zero, while European roulette provides better odds at 2.7%.

Remember that the house edge is a long-term mathematical principle. Over a single session, luck can prevail, but extended play naturally favors the casino. Choose games with lower house edges if you want better long-term value, and always gamble with money you can afford to lose.
The key to responsible gambling is recognizing that the odds are designed for the casino’s benefit and playing purely for entertainment rather than as income.
